How Much Does a Computer Really Cost in Nigeria?

Figuring out a cost of a desktop in Nigeria can be somewhat challenging. It's not simply a matter of checking a one number . Many factors affect the including customs charges, exchange rates, market demand, and even manufacturer preference. You'll usually find that modern laptops start from around Eighty thousand Naira for a basic model, going up to two hundred and fifty thousand Naira or higher for advanced setups . Desktops are likely to a slightly less expensive, with ₦60,000 and increasing to two hundred K for a good work setup . Used PCs provide a much affordable alternative, although condition can fluctuate significantly, therefore proper inspection is vital .

  • Think about import tariffs.
  • Research Nigerian retailer costs .
  • Account for Naira rate shifts .

Buying a Computer Online in Nigeria: Tips & Considerations

Acquiring a system online in Nigeria can be a easy process, but it’s essential to approach it with awareness. The scene is flooded with sellers, offering offers that seem too good to be true. Therefore, due diligence is utterly needed. First, investigate the credibility of the website. Look for customer reviews and testimonials – a favorable history is a important indicator. Furthermore, verify the assurance details; a trustworthy supplier should offer appropriate protection against faults. Evaluate the shipping costs and delivery times – these can occasionally be unexpectedly high. Finally, pay with a secure payment option like a credit card with security features or a known online payment solution.

  • Check seller ratings.
  • Contrast prices from various sites.
  • Be aware of the return rules.
  • Inspect pictures carefully.
  • Ask about features if something is ambiguous.
